#43b7e5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#43b7e5 is composed of 26.3% red, 71.8%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.7% cyan, 20.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 197 degrees, a saturation of 75.7% and a lightness of 58%. #43b7e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ffff with #006fcb.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#43b7e5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#43b7e5 has RGB values of R:67, G:183,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 4437989.

Hex triplet 43b7e5 #43b7e5
RGB Decimal 67, 183, 229 rgb(67,183,229)
RGB Percent 26.3, 71.8, 89.8 rgb(26.3%,71.8%,89.8%)
CMYK 71, 20, 0, 10
HSL 197°, 75.7, 58 hsl(197,75.7%,58%)
HSV (or HSB) 197°, 70.7, 89.8
Web Safe 33cccc #33cccc
CIE-LAB 69.976, -17.793, -32.405
XYZ 33.387, 40.715, 80.224
xyY 0.216, 0.264, 40.715
CIE-LCH 69.976, 36.968, 241.23
CIE-LUV 69.976, -42.663, -49.291
Hunter-Lab 63.808, -18.264, -29.878
Binary 01000011, 10110111, 11100101

Shades and Tints of #43b7e5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eff9fd is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#43b7e5 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9a9a9a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#89a0a9 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#a1addd Protanopia 1% of men
  • #9aadeb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#34bfcd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7fb0e0 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#7ab0e9 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#3abcd6 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
